Just wanted to say I'm very happy to NOT hear anything about Emmanuel Nwodo after this fight. It looked as if Darnell Wilson crawled into the corner to pray he hadn't killed Nwodo following the knockout. The ref should have stopped that thing when it was clear to everyone what was coming. The knockout was on the level of James Kinchen-Alex Ramos or Hilton vs. Wilfred Benitez. Nothing left but sad, worrisome wreckage. Emmanuel fought well throughout and Ding-A-Ling, as usual, made a lot of mistakes and looked awkward and inactive, all of which he compensated for, as usual, with his world's-finest punching power and wonderful ability to somehow get out of the way of heavy shots. His devastating fists, granite chin, cool demeanor and barrel of confidence carry him a long way, but Darnell was losing much of that fight, and was losing rounds even after Emmanuel's vision blurred. I don't know if at his age he's going to tighten things up and become a more economical fighter, but he couldn't possibly make himself any more dangerous. He's the Beltway's best for the first half of the year.
